197 /* map serial_X to iobase and irq */
198 static const struct {
199 int iobase;
200 int irq;
201 } MCA_SERIAL[] = {
202 { 0x03f8, 4 }, /* SERIAL_1 */
203 { 0x02f8, 3 }, /* SERIAL_2 */
204 { 0x3220, 3 }, /* SERIAL_3 */
205 { 0x3228, 3 }, /* SERIAL_4 */
206 { 0x4220, 3 }, /* SERIAL_5 */
207 { 0x4228, 3 }, /* SERIAL_6 */
208 { 0x5220, 3 }, /* SERIAL_7 */
209 { 0x5228, 3 }, /* SERIAL_8 */
210 };
211
212 /*
213 * Get config for IBM Internal Modem (ID 0xEDFF). This beast doesn't
214 * seem to support even AT commands, it's good as example for adding
215 * other stuff though.
216 */
217 static int
218 ibm_modem_getcfg(struct mca_attach_args *ma, int *iobasep, int *irqp)
219 {
220 int pos2;
221 int snum;
222
223 pos2 = mca_conf_read(ma->ma_mc, ma->ma_slot, 2);
224
225 /*
226 * POS register 2: (adf pos0)
227 * 7 6 5 4 3 2 1 0
228 * \__/ \__ enable: 0=adapter disabled, 1=adapter enabled
229 * \_____ Serial Configuration: XX=SERIAL_XX
230 */
231
232 snum = (pos2 & 0x0e) >> 1;
233
234 *iobasep = MCA_SERIAL[snum].iobase;
235 *irqp = MCA_SERIAL[snum].irq;
236
237 return (0);
238 }
239
240 /*
241 * Get configuration for NeoTecH Single RS-232 Async. Adapter, SM110.
242 */
243 static int
244 neocom1_getcfg(struct mca_attach_args *ma, int *iobasep, int *irqp)
245 {
246 int pos2, pos3, pos4;
247 static const int neotech_irq[] = { 12, 9, 4, 3 };
248
249 pos2 = mca_conf_read(ma->ma_mc, ma->ma_slot, 2);
250 pos3 = mca_conf_read(ma->ma_mc, ma->ma_slot, 3);
251 pos4 = mca_conf_read(ma->ma_mc, ma->ma_slot, 4);
252
253 /*
254 * POS register 2: (adf pos0)
255 * 7 6 5 4 3 2 1 0
256 * 1 \_/ \__ enable: 0=adapter disabled, 1=adapter enabled
257 * \____ IRQ: 11=3 10=4 01=9 00=12
258 *
259 * POS register 3: (adf pos1)
260 * 7 6 5 4 3 2 1 0
261 * \______/
262 * \_________ I/O Address: bits 7-3
263 *
264 * POS register 4: (adf pos2)
265 * 7 6 5 4 3 2 1 0
266 * \_____________/
267 * \__ I/O Address: bits 15-8
268 */
269
270 *iobasep = (pos4 << 8) | (pos3 & 0xf8);
271 *irqp = neotech_irq[(pos2 & 0x06) >> 1];
272
273 return (0);
274 }
275
276 /*
277 * Get configuration for IBM Multi-Protocol Communications Adapter.
278 * We only support SERIAL mode, bail out if set to SDLC or BISYNC.
279 */
280 static int
281 ibm_mpcom_getcfg(struct mca_attach_args *ma, int *iobasep, int *irqp)
282 {
283 int snum, pos2;
284
285 pos2 = mca_conf_read(ma->ma_mc, ma->ma_slot, 2);
286
287 /*
288 * For SERIAL mode, bit 4 has to be 0.
289 *
290 * POS register 2: (adf pos0)
291 * 7 6 5 4 3 2 1 0
292 * 0 \__/ \__ enable: 0=adapter disabled, 1=adapter enabled
293 * \_____ Serial Configuration: XX=SERIAL_XX
294 */
295
296 if (pos2 & 0x10) {
297 aprint_error(": not set to SERIAL mode, ignored\n");
298 return (1);
299 }
300
301 snum = (pos2 & 0x0e) >> 1;
302
303 *iobasep = MCA_SERIAL[snum].iobase;
304 *irqp = MCA_SERIAL[snum].irq;
305
306 return (0);
307 }
